Subject: [PATCH v2 4/4] leds: leds-ns2: depends on MACH_ARMADA_370
Date: Thu, 2 Jul 2015 19:56:43 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1435859803-19583-5-git-send-email-simon.guinot@sequanux.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1435859803-19583-1-git-send-email-simon.guinot@sequanux.org>
The leds-ns2 driver is also used by the n090401 board (Seagate NAS
4-Bay), which is based on the Marvell Armada-370 SoC.
Then this patch allows to select the leds-ns2 driver if MACH_ARMADA_370
is enabled. Additionally, this also updates the Kconfig help message.
